aboutsummaryrefslogtreecommitdiff
path: root/gcc/c
AgeCommit message (Expand)AuthorFilesLines
2024-01-03Update copyright years.Jakub Jelinek19-19/+19
2024-01-03Update Copyright year in ChangeLog filesJakub Jelinek1-1/+1
2023-12-31Daily bump.GCC Administrator1-0/+4
2023-12-30C: Fix type compatibility for structs with variable sized fields.Martin Uecker1-11/+8
2023-12-23Daily bump.GCC Administrator1-0/+9
2023-12-22c23: construct composite type for tagged typesMartin Uecker2-27/+134
2023-12-22Daily bump.GCC Administrator1-0/+41
2023-12-21c23: aliasing of compatible tagged typesMartin Uecker4-1/+87
2023-12-21c23: tag compatibility rules for enumsMartin Uecker4-12/+66
2023-12-21c23: tag compatibility rules for struct and unionsMartin Uecker3-12/+99
2023-12-21Daily bump.GCC Administrator1-0/+11
2023-12-20c: Split -Wcalloc-transposed-args warning from -Walloc-size, -Walloc-size fixesJakub Jelinek2-28/+31
2023-12-20Daily bump.GCC Administrator1-0/+22
2023-12-19OpenMP: Use enumerators for names of trait-sets and traitsSandra Loosemore1-160/+82
2023-12-19OpenMP: Unify representation of name-list properties.Sandra Loosemore1-2/+3
2023-12-19OpenMP: Introduce accessor macros and constructors for context selectors.Sandra Loosemore1-10/+17
2023-12-19Daily bump.GCC Administrator1-0/+6
2023-12-18c/111975 - GIMPLE FE dumping and parsing of TARGET_MEM_REFRichard Biener1-9/+57
2023-12-14Daily bump.GCC Administrator1-0/+26
2023-12-13c-family: rename warn_for_address_or_pointer_of_packed_memberJason Merrill1-2/+2
2023-12-13OpenMP/OpenACC: Rework clause expansion and nested struct handlingJulian Brown2-247/+197
2023-12-13OpenMP/OpenACC: Reindent TO/FROM/_CACHE_ stanza in {c_}finish_omp_clauseJulian Brown1-296/+301
2023-12-12Daily bump.GCC Administrator1-0/+15
2023-12-11Fix regression causing ICE for structs with VLAs [PR 112488]Martin Uecker3-10/+28
2023-12-11OpenMP: Support acquires/release in 'omp require atomic_default_mem_order'Tobias Burnus1-2/+30
2023-12-06Daily bump.GCC Administrator1-0/+11
2023-12-05Restore build with GCC 4.8 to GCC 5Richard Sandiford1-1/+1
2023-12-05c/86869 - preserve address-space info when building qualified ARRAY_TYPERichard Biener1-0/+1
2023-12-03Daily bump.GCC Administrator1-0/+12
2023-12-02Allow target attributes in non-gnu namespacesRichard Sandiford3-10/+18
2023-12-02Daily bump.GCC Administrator1-0/+53
2023-12-01c: Add new -Wdeclaration-missing-parameter-type permerrorFlorian Weimer1-2/+4
2023-12-01c: Turn -Wincompatible-pointer-types into a permerrorFlorian Weimer1-27/+35
2023-12-01c: Turn -Wreturn-mismatch into a permerrorFlorian Weimer1-2/+2
2023-12-01c: Do not ignore some forms of -Wimplicit-int in system headersFlorian Weimer1-1/+1
2023-12-01c: Turn -Wimplicit-int into a permerrorFlorian Weimer1-31/+12
2023-12-01c: Turn -Wimplicit-function-declaration into a permerrorFlorian Weimer1-10/+10
2023-12-01c: Turn int-conversion warnings into permerrorsFlorian Weimer1-37/+60
2023-11-30Daily bump.GCC Administrator1-0/+11
2023-11-29Introduce hardbool attribute for CAlexandre Oliva3-1/+54
2023-11-29Daily bump.GCC Administrator1-0/+13
2023-11-28c++: prvalue array decay [PR94264]Jason Merrill1-1/+1
2023-11-28middle-end/112741 - ICE with gimple FE and later regimplificationRichard Biener1-1/+7
2023-11-28Daily bump.GCC Administrator1-0/+9
2023-11-27c-family: Implement __has_feature and __has_extension [PR60512]Alex Coplan3-0/+45
2023-11-25Daily bump.GCC Administrator1-0/+15
2023-11-24OpenMP: Add -Wopenmp and use itTobias Burnus1-16/+24
2023-11-24OpenMP: Accept argument to depobj's destroy clauseTobias Burnus1-1/+23
2023-11-24Daily bump.GCC Administrator1-0/+5
2023-11-23c: Add __builtin_stdc_* builtinsJakub Jelinek2-1/+293